Output 51a38a6b0cbb645ef63aa86673bc431b3ba7e27dea825b7ea1b1c3d2e38c0a5d:6

value
11025949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46086cafda4d2152c165fa59fde0bfd01f91d420 OP_EQUAL
address
385KKKYGQq27WxqTBWXaRdSvftykR82BKV
transaction
51a38a6b0cbb645ef63aa86673bc431b3ba7e27dea825b7ea1b1c3d2e38c0a5d
confirmations
121513
spent
true